Transaction df21c87148f2933a940fd560bd995177712942076634ed8390927c87933483e2
2 Input
2 Outputs
- df21c87148f2933a940fd560bd995177712942076634ed8390927c87933483e2:0
- df21c87148f2933a940fd560bd995177712942076634ed8390927c87933483e2:1
value 572288
address 1B3W2fHRt1JU833drJkkrptWksUzNEUbQ8
value 11940000
address 1Kv7oPFszpqdaWWR7jbCdgd2k28mV4ndj2